On October 17, 2008, DEC Environmental Conservation Officers (DEC) charged two men with killing a moose in the Adirondack Town of Keene, Essex County. DEC Dispatch received a report of a moose being shot earlier in the day.

So, a few weeks ago there was some buzz on the street about the new trail up Lyon Mt. Not often we get new trails in the Adirondacks – especially purpose-built hiking trails. The old trail up is an example of the old-style of hiking where the “direct route” was favored. I won’t bore you with a trip report. What you need to know is this: The trail is longer. Though much easier, it takes about an hour longer.
